Chat
Search
Ithy Logo

Implementing and Monitoring Microsoft Copilot Studio Agents

A detailed guide for administrators to deploy, secure, and manage Copilot Studio agents

office technology workspace

Key Highlights

  • Robust Security and Data Protection: Ensure comprehensive encryption, persistent label inheritance, and data loss prevention policies.
  • Effective Governance and Compliance: Use administration centers and enforced policies to govern and monitor agent behavior.
  • Visibility, Monitoring, and Cost Control: Utilize dashboards, analytics, logging, and billing options to manage usage and expenses.

Overview

Microsoft Copilot Studio offers administrators a platform to create, deploy, and monitor advanced agents that improve operational workflows and enhance user interactions within the Microsoft ecosystem. With a focus on robust security, comprehensive governance, and efficient monitoring, this guide details the critical steps administrators should follow to implement and monitor Copilot Studio Agents effectively. It outlines the necessary steps for configuration, deployment, data protection, compliance, and continuous monitoring to ensure seamless and secure operations.

Step-by-Step Implementation Guide

1. Setting Up and Creating Agents

Begin with the creation of agents either by using the Copilot Studio's guided setup or through manual configuration. Administrators have various methods at their disposal:

A. Guided Setup via Copilot Studio

Access Copilot Studio through the Microsoft 365 Admin Center. Here, the guided setup will prompt you to answer questions regarding the agent’s purpose, target audience, tone, and the sources from which it will draw its knowledge base. Utilizing templates provided by Microsoft can speed up the process for common agent scenarios.

B. Manual Agent Creation

Alternatively, administrators can manually configure agents by using the "⊕ Create" option. This method allows for greater customization by specifying the agent's name, description, icon, and detailed instructions. Manual creation is ideal when pre-defined templates do not sufficiently cover your organizational needs.

C. Integration with Custom APIs and Connectors

Enhance the agent's capabilities by integrating over 1500 connectors or your custom APIs. This integration allows the agent to access and process data across different platforms, ensuring that it can serve diverse roles within the organization.

2. Implementing Data Protection Framework

Data protection is at the core of deploying Copilot Studio Agents. It involves ensuring that all transactions and data accesses are secure, preventing leakage of sensitive information:

A. Encryption in Transit and at Rest

Secure the data managed by these agents by mandating encryption both during transmission and while stored. Utilize industry-standard encryption protocols to maintain data integrity and confidentiality.

B. Persistent Label Inheritance

Agents should use persistent label inheritance so that any new content automatically inherits the sensitivity labels assigned to its source. This approach ensures that data loss prevention (DLP) policies are consistently applied across all content.

C. Endpoint Management and Conditional Access

Employ endpoint management solutions to control device compliance, and use risk-based conditional access to minimize vulnerabilities. These measures restrict access based on user risk levels and device security postures, offering an additional layer of protection.

3. Establishing Governance Framework

Robust governance ensures that agents are managed effectively and operate within the organizational compliance requirements. Journey through the following components:

A. Administration Centers

Leverage the Microsoft 365 Admin Center and the Power Platform Admin Center to manage permissions, policies, and compliance settings across your organization. These centralized dashboards provide direct control over agent deployment and monitoring.

B. Connector Management Policies

Establish and enforce policies that govern data flows across connectors and services. This ensures that only approved data streams are used by agents, preventing unauthorized access or data leakage.

C. Activity Logging and Auditing

Enable detailed logging and auditing for all interactions that agents have with users and data sources. Regular audits facilitate early detection of anomalies and maintain compliance with regulatory requirements. Log files should be reviewed periodically to enhance security and improve operational efficiency.

4. Monitoring Agent Performance and Usage

Continuous monitoring is crucial for identifying issues, optimizing performance, and ensuring security. Utilize a range of tools and dashboards to maintain real-time visibility:

A. Usage and Performance Analytics

Monitor agent performance using the Copilot Dashboard integrated within the admin center. This tool provides real-time analytics on usage, performance metrics, and security indicators. Regularly review these analytics to adjust configurations and improve overall efficiency.

B. Data Security Posture Management (DSPM) for AI

Implement DSPM tools to proactively identify and mitigate risks associated with data handling by agents. These tools analyze user interactions, detect potential vulnerabilities, and provide recommendations to maintain a secure data posture.

C. Inventory and Reporting

The Microsoft 365 Admin Center offers an inventory view of all deployed agents. Utilize the built-in Usage Report to compile data on agent interactions, ensuring that you have actionable insights into performance trends and areas of improvement. This structured inventory helps administrators track changes and gauge the success of agent implementations.

5. Cost Management and Consumption Planning

Administrators should balance operational efficiency with cost-effectiveness. Developing a clear consumption plan will assist in managing expenses:

A. Pre-Paid Licensing vs. Metered Billing

Evaluate whether a pre-paid licensing model or a metered billing system better suits your organization’s needs. Metered billing allows for precise cost control linked to actual usage, ensuring accountability and cost optimization.

B. Budget Design and Cost Forecasting

Establish a budget for Copilot Studio Agent usage, using insights from historical data and predicted growth metrics. This forward-thinking approach not only ensures controlled spending but also secures resources for scaling the agent infrastructure as your organization grows.


Consolidated Overview Table

Implementation Aspect Key Actions
Agent Creation
  • Use guided setup or manual creation
  • Integrate custom APIs and connectors
  • Utilize provided templates for common tasks
Data Protection
  • Encrypt data in transit and at rest
  • Implement persistent label inheritance
  • Apply DLP policies and conditional access
Governance Framework
  • Utilize centralized admin centers
  • Enforce connector management policies
  • Enable logging and auditing of all activities
Monitoring
  • Use Copilot Dashboard for real-time analytics
  • Deploy DSPM tools for proactive risk identification
  • Review usage reports and agent inventory regularly
Cost Management
  • Choose between pre-paid and metered billing models
  • Set budgets based on usage insights
  • Monitor expenses and adjust licensing accordingly

Additional Recommendations for Administrators

Training and Best Practices

Alongside technical configuration, it is essential to invest in training sessions and knowledge-sharing forums. Administrators should regularly participate in webinars, workshops, or community forums that focus on the evolving landscape of AI agents and Microsoft’s platforms. Developing an internal documentation framework can be beneficial for tracking standard operating procedures (SOPs) and best practices, ensuring that both new and experienced staff are aware of the latest developments and security protocols.

Regular Audits and Compliance Checks

Scheduling periodic audits helps ensure that your governance and compliance frameworks remain robust. Regular reviews of activity logs, usage reports, and data access patterns minimize the risk of security breaches. Audit findings should drive revisions to policies and practices, reinforcing the overall integrity of your agent deployments.

Feedback and Continuous Improvement

Establish a clear feedback loop with end-users and technical teams to continuously improve agent performance. Constructive feedback is essential in identifying potential issues or areas for enhancement. Administrators should leverage these insights to adjust configurations, update training modules, and refine the operation of the agents, ensuring that they evolve alongside organizational needs.

Integration with Broader Ecosystem

Integrating Copilot Studio Agents into the wider Microsoft ecosystem, such as embedding them within Microsoft Teams or internal websites, extends their utility and ensures seamless workflows. By interlinking these agents with pre-existing applications, administrators can optimize various operational tasks and enhance overall productivity.


References

Recommended Related Queries


Last updated March 13, 2025
Ask Ithy AI
Export Article
Delete Article